Wayne Cormany, 75, passed away on February 16, 2022. He was born June 21, 1946, in Canton, and was raised on the family dairy farm in Green. He was a 1964 graduate of Green High School, served in the Army National Guard from 1965 to 1971. Wayne married Paddy (Hileman) on October 5, 1968. Wayne worked at Acro Tool & Die, as a tire builder for B. F. Goodrich, and in the testing department at Michelin Tire, until his retirement.
Wayne loved to travel, visiting New England, the western United States, Alaska, Bermuda, Punta Cana, and most recently, Ireland and Scotland. He loved sports, building things, working on cars and trucks, and listening to the “oldies.” Wayne enjoyed camping and making “moonshine” and salsa for the Camping Club but most of all he loved and adored his wife, daughters, and grandkids.
In addition to his parents, Harold and Velma Cormany, Wayne was preceded in death by an infant son; brothers, Glenn (Jackie) and Bob (Helen) Cormany; sisters, Norma (Chuck) Richards and Dorothy (Bob) McGary. He is survived by his loving wife of 53 years, Paddy Cormany; daughters, Cassie (Ed) Burgy, Colleen (Ted) Grabowski, and Kimi (Michael) Orlowski; grandchildren, Aurora, Brynne, Michael, Lexi, Brigid, and Maire; mother-in-law, Joyce Hileman; sisters-in-law, Kathy (Rod) Thomas and Missy (Richard) Sandy; brothers-in-law, David (Monica) Hileman and Dennis Hileman; as well as many nieces, nephews, and too many friends to mention.
